About Me

I am originally from Nova Scotia and moved to BC over 10 years ago to pursue new opportunities. I completed my undergraduate degree in Psychology and Criminology, my Masters degree in Counselling Psychology, and am currently completing my Doctorate in Clinical Psychology. I work with both youth and adults and have experience treating and contributing to the healing of a range of difficulties and mental health diagnosis such as depression, anxiety, bipolar, trauma and PTSD, schizophrenia-spectrum disorders, psychosis, substance abuse, and BPD.

Therapeutic Approach

I work through a trauma-informed and inclusive approach guided by evidence-based modalities. I consistently seek out new training opportunities to be able to provide my clients with as many clinically effective tools as possible, with a primary focus on a collaborative therapeutic relationship with my clients, which is often one of the strongest factors in outcomes. I focus not only on what is distressing and problematic for my clients, but also on strengths and what is working and going well. I am known for creating a space that is safe, collabrative, compassionate, and client-centered and my goal is to provide clients with the tools they need to be able to manage the difficulties that come up in life independently.
